The Squier Vintage Modified Precision Bass TB vibe is the classic ’70s era “Tele Bass” design, complete with thumping low-end tone from the Fender®-designed large humbucking pickup. Other features include a dual brass-saddle bridge (string-through design) and gorgeous sunburst finish over ash veneers on the top and back of the instrument. Players from beginner to intermediate and beyond have done it for years—whether installing hotter pickups, alternate pickguards, or just plain personalizing their instruments with fancy paint jobs, modified means adding new twists to a familiar design. Basswood body with ash top and back
Maple neck
Maple fingerboard
20 medium jumbo frets
Custom Fender-designed humbucking pickup
Volume and Tone control knobs
Open gear tuners
Dual brass-saddle bridge with string thru body
Chrome hardware
3-ply pickguard
34" scale
